摘要 |
Die Erfindung betrifft ein Steuerverfahren für einen Roboter (1) mit mehreren beweglichen Roboterachsen (2, 4, 6), insbesondere für einen Lackierroboter (1) oder einen Handhabungsroboter, mit den Schritten: (a) Vorgabe einer Roboterbahn durch mehrere Bahnpunkte, die von einem Referenzpunkt des Roboters (1) durchfahren werden sollen, (b) Ansteuerung von Antriebsmotoren der einzelnen Roboterachsen (2, 4, 6) entsprechend der vorgegebenen Roboterbahn, so dass der Referenzpunkt des Roboters (1) die vorgegebene Roboterbahn durchfährt, (c) Vorausberechnung der mechanischen Belastung (My1, Mx1, Fx1, Fy1, Fz1, Fx2, Fy2, Fz2, Mx2, My2, Mz2), die innerhalb mindestens einer der Roboterachsen (2, 4, 6) zwischen zwei Gelenken beim Durchfahren der bevorstehenden Roboterbahn auftritt, sowie (d) Anpassung der Ansteuerung der Antriebsmotoren der Roboterachsen (2, 4, 6) in Abhängigkeit von der vorausberechneten mechanischen Belastung (My1, Mx1, Fx1, Fy1, Fz1, Fx2, Fy2, Fz2, Mx2, My2, Mz2), so dass eine mechanische Überlastung vermieden wird.
|